Mahathir spoke his mind, says Subra

KLANG: Datuk S. Subramaniam said Tun Dr Mahathir Mohamad’s endorsement of him as the deputy president of the MIC was a “fair comment” by the former Prime Minister.

“We can’t suppress a fair comment and I feel Dr Mahathir is just being fair as he spoke his mind without fear or favour.

“I did not orchestrate the news and it was the newspaper that had come out with the report,” he said.

He was commenting on a front-page report of Makkal Osai yesterday which quoted Dr Mahathir as taking a swipe at MIC president S. Samy Vellu for being “too long” in the party.

Speaking to reporters after meeting about 900 supporters and delegates at the Lourdes Hall at Jalan Tengku Kelana here, Subramaniam said Samy Vellu could not accept it that Dr Mahathir had supported him.

The former MIC deputy president said the Indians should heed Dr Mahathir’s calls for them to progress by removing the party president.

“For the Indian community to progress, we must bring a change in MIC,” he said.
